As an outgrowth of my love for modern American folk dancing, especially contra dances, I started my Club Contras project with my brother Clayton in 2011 as a contribution to the relatively new trend of "techno" or crossover contras. These dances typically feature a caller and a DJ rather than (or sometimes in addition to) live musicians, along with special lighting effects to approximate a dance club atmosphere. I have produced Club Contra dance events all over the East Coast, often using the stage name "DJ B-Ham."
Often due to space and budget constraints I am booked as both the DJ and caller for an event, especially for smaller local dance nights or dance weekend "late-night techno after-parties" up to two hours. On the other hand, local Club Contra dances in Virginia have also featured guest artists DJ Solar Sound, DJ Nu B and DJ Improper as well as several guest callers who have had briefing or outside experience in this unique format.
